May 19 (SeeNews) - The Bulgarian Stock Exchange blue-chip SOFIX index rose 0.35% to 451.33 points on Tuesday, as heavyweight drug maker Sopharma [BUL:3JR] gained most among its members.
Sopharma's share price rose 2.45% to 2.93 levs on Tuesday, following a 1.38% decrease on Monday.
Diversified group Stara Planina Hold [BUL:5SR] lender Central Cooperative Bank (CCB) [BUL:4CF] followed with gains of 1.22% and 0.95%, respectively.
The wider BGBX40 index, which tracks the 40 most traded shares on the Sofia bourse, advanced 0.39% to 96.03 points, while the BGTR30 index, in which companies with a free float of at least 10% have equal weight, rose by 0.24% to 466.45 points.
Both indexes were supported by a 3.33% increase in the share price of financial and insurance group Eurohold Bulgaria [BUL:4EH].
The BGREIT index, which tracks seven real estate investment trusts, added 0.11% to 133.43 points.
Total regulated market trading turnover amounted to some 212,000 levs ($119,000/108,000 euro).
(1 euro = 1.95583 levs)
